    This week, Zion Williamson, Luka Doncic and Jayson Tatum traveled to China as part of the Jordan Brand Family Tour. The trip marked the first of its kind of Jordan brand, with Williamson, Doncic, Tatum and Paolo Banchero all traveling overseas midway through the week. Heading into the weekend, the group visited the Great Wall of China.

    The stop was just one of many that the group is making, with planned stops at various locations around Shanghai and Beijing. Along the way, the group of Jordan Brand athletes will also stop at youth camps in the area, as well as the finals of a streetball tournament.

    Early Saturday morning in the US, the afternoon in China, the group was filmed hiking a segment of the Great Wall of China. The video opens with Jayson Tatum joking about how scared he is of heights before the camera then cuts to Luka Doncic, who was seen hiking the Great Wall with a walking stick.

    The video then cuts to Zion Williamson, who states that he’s doing well, but it’s simply too hot for him. According to AccuWeather.com, Huairou District experienced temperatures as high as 88°F with 85% humidity on Saturday afternoon.

    The clip also features a guest appearance from Luka Doncic’s father, who fans joked was in better shape than the Mavericks star.

    Looking closer at the details of the Jordan Brand China tour ft. Zion Williamson, Jayson Tatum, Luka Doncic and Paolo Banchero

    The Jordan Brand tour of China was announced earlier in the week, with the brand putting out a press release. As the press release explained, the goal of the tour is to spread the game of basketball, while also connecting fans around the globe with some of the NBA’s biggest stars.

    As Jordan Brand’s VP of the region explained in a press release, relayed by Nike:

    “It’s exciting to welcome Jayson, Luka, Zion and Paolo to China and celebrate the growth of both the game of basketball and Jordan Brand here. They represent the greatness that is the hallmark of Jordan Brand.

    “This tour, while celebrating the community we’ve built in China, also showcases the resonance of basketball culture across the entire globe. It’s a universal language and shows that the future of the Brand is limitless.”

    In addition to the tour making several big stops at notable locations such as the Great Wall of China, the tour also saw Jayson Tatum unveil the Tatum 3 after previously wearing them in Paris while preparing for the Olympics.

    The shoe design, which Tatum unveiled for fans in China this week, notably featured traditional Chinese artwork, according to Sneaker News.

    After unveiling the shoes, Tatum left fans stunned as he autographed the demo pair of the Tatum 3 before giving them to a fan who had followed his career since the beginning.

    Gondrezick was the fourth pick in the 2021 WNBA Draft when the Indiana Fever selected her. The Fever released her in 2022, which led to her being picked up by the Chicago Sky.

    However, the Sky waived her before the start of the 2022 season. She spent 2023 as a free agent, and earlier this year, the Sky signed her again. Gondrezick was part of the opening day roster this time, but after only five games, she was waived again.

    Gondrezick has played in 24 WNBA games, 19 for the Fever and five for the Sky this season. In those 24 games, she has averaged 1.7 points per game while shooting 28.3% from the field and 26.5% from beyond the arc.

    Adele is saying goodbye to performing for a while.

    A fan shared a video on TikTok of the singer during a recent performance in Munich, Germany, where she said she’s planning a lengthy break after her Las Vegas residency.

    “I have 10 shows to do, but after that I will not see you for an incredibly long time, and I will hold you dear in my heart.”

    Representatives for Adele did not immediately return Fox News Digital’s request for comment.

    Adele singing on stage with video behind her

    Adele said on stage that she would not see fans “for an incredibly long time.” (Kevin Mazur/Getty Images for AD)

    Adele has been performing her Las Vegas residency at The Colosseum Theater at Caesars Palace since November 2022.

    She initially announced this residency in 2021, only to stun and disappoint fans months later by postponing the tour entirely. In an emotional video, the “Rolling in the Deep” singer told fans that the caliber of her show was not up to par and that she and her crew wouldn’t be ready to begin on time.

    Once the shows began, Adele extended her dates into 2023 and again through most of 2024. Her last shows are set to run from Oct. 25 through November 23 this year.

    In July, the Grammy-winner told Germany’s ZDF public broadcast service she was looking to do other “creative things.”

    On Sunday, Milwaukee Bucks superstar forward Giannis Antetokounmpo married his longtime partner, Mariah Riddlesprigger. Their extravagant wedding, reportedly set in the two-time MVP’s native Greece, featured several of his current and former teammates.

    Best man Khris Middleton, Jrue Holiday and Bucks center pose at Giannis Antetokounmpo

    Antetokounmpo and Riddlesprigger, who have three children together, Liam, Maverick Shai and Eva Brooke, have been together since around the mid-2010s. Thus, Bucks fans have long anticipated the couple tying the knot.

    According to Greek media outlets, their three-day wedding celebration took place at Costa Navarino, a luxury beachfront destination in Messenia in Greece’s southwest Peloponnese region.

    The festivities reportedly began on Friday with a white dress party. The following day, the couple hosted a Nigerian-themed bash, paying homage to Antetokounmpo’s Nigerian roots.

    Per Skai TV, Antetokounmpo and Riddlesprigger were wed in a Greek Orthodox and Catholic hybrid ceremony, with Milwaukee star wing Khris Middleton serving as best man.

    Middleton has been Antetokounmpo’s wingman throughout the latter’s NBA career, which began in 2013. The duo, which led the Bucks to the 2021 NBA title, have developed a strong bond on and off the court. Three years ago, Antetokounmpo described their journey as “unbelievable.”

    Milwaukee big man Bobby Portis and Antetokounmpo’s former teammates Jrue Holiday and Wesley Matthews also attended the wedding. On Sunday, Bucks insider Nathan Marzion shared a photo on X, formerly Twitter, of the group posing together.

    However, none of Antetokounmpo and Riddlesprigger’s wedding photos have been publicized.

    According to the Proto Thema newspaper, the eight-time All-Star opted for a private ceremony without media coverage. He and Riddlesprigger reportedly even asked those involved to sign confidentiality agreements to ensure their privacy.

    Anthony Edwards didn’t have great success with Georgia

    Edwards entered the Bulldogs’ programs as one of the highest-ranked players in the country. Just like any other collegiate star, he played one season as a necessity to enter the league. During the run, he averaged 19.2 points, the second most in the program’s history by a freshman. It was here that his charismatic personality and explosive athleticism came to the notice of the basketball world.

    A star was born within their ranks. But as far as the team goes, they achieved rather underwhelming results. The team, under second-year coach Tom Crean, finished with a 16-16 record despite having a well-constructed roster around their star player. As the ace, Edwards though didn’t have the opportunity of having a full season due to the pandemic.

    If it wasn’t for the shortened campaign, there could have been a resurgence that might have increased the already exponential allure of Ant-Man. However, it didn’t waver his draft projections. Edwards remained the ace.

    The Minnesota Timberwolves didn’t stutter to pick him with the first pick in the 2020 draft. As his story proves, he was the transformational component the Wolves were after.
